Overview 
 Job Summary Details:    The Dispatcher receives assistance requests from clients and customers, and assigns individuals and teams to respond to those requests.

       Basic Qualifications:    •  Must be 18 years of age or older    
   •  No high school diploma, GED or college degree required.    
   •  No experience required and on the job training provided.    
Preferred Qualifications:    •  One (1) year of prior multi-line reception experience or dispatching experience preferred    
Responsibilities:    •  Establish and maintain effective communication and working relationships with clients, co-workers, shift coordinators, supervisors, managers, etc.     
   •  Schedule and dispatch resources, which may be team members, crews/teams, equipment, or service vehicles, to appropriate locations according to customer requests, specifications, or needs, using radios, telephones, and/or computers; determines types or amounts of equipment, vehicles, materials, or personnel required according to work orders or client requirements     
   •  Ensure timely and efficient movement of resources according to work orders and/or resource schedules     
   •  Oversee all communications within specifically assigned area(s)    
   •  Receive or prepare work orders and work schedules     
   •  Record and maintain files and records of customer requests, work, or services performed, inventory, and other dispatch information     
   •  Recognize and mitigate a variety of issues encountered within the department and other work environments    
   •  Confer with clients and/or supervising personnel in order to address questions, problems, and requests for resources     
   •  Monitor resources and utilization in order to coordinate services and schedules to achieve optimal efficiency;    
   •  Compile statistics and reports on work progress.    
   •  Monitor daily services and provide updates and reports    
   •  Comply with all safety, security, compliance, and quality standards and procedures established by the Company, Clients, and regulatory authorities.
